Hanover, New Hampshire, United States

Overview

Hanover is a charming college town in New Hampshire, home to Dartmouth College and set in the scenic Upper Valley. The city offers a blend of cultural events, outdoor activities, and historic New England ambiance.

Best Time to Visit

September-October for fall foliage or May-June for pleasant spring weather.

Local Tips

Downtown parking can be limited; consider walking or cycling. Many spots, including nature trails, are within easy reach on foot.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ping 15-20% is standard at restaurants. Casual attire is widely accepted, but smart-casual is common in finer establishments.

Safety Warnings

Hanover is very safe with low crime rates. Exercise normal precautions at night and be cautious during winter weather conditions.

Hidden Gems

Visit the Hood Museum of Art, hike Pine Park trails, or grab a pastry at Lou's Bakery, an iconic local spot.
